The plane of Chinese President Xi Jinping is approaching Moscow.
This is evidenced by data from the flightradar24 portal.
If the visit goes ahead as planned, Xi Jinping will become the first world leader to meet Vladimir Putin in person since the International Criminal Court (ICC) in The Hague issued an arrest warrant for the Russian dictator on March 17.
It will be recalled that the three-day visit of the Chinese leader
Xi Jinping
to Russia begins today.
The event is taking place at the invitation of the Russian side.
During his last visit to Moscow in 2019, Xi Jinping called Vladimir Putin his best friend.
Since then, the geopolitical situation in the world has undergone rapid changes, and the positions of both politicians have also changed.
The last time Putin and Xi Jinping met in person was in September 2022 at the summit of the Shanghai Cooperation Organization in Samarkand.
Then the Chinese leader did not shake hands with his "best friend".
